#BDDE1E Hex Color Code

#BDDE1E

The Hexadecimal Color #BDDE1E is a contrast shade of Green Yellow. #BDDE1E RGB value is rgb(189, 222, 30). RGB Color Model of #BDDE1E consists of 74% red, 87% green and 11% blue. HSL color Mode of #BDDE1E has 70°(degrees) Hue, 76% Saturation and 49% Lightness. #BDDE1E color has an wavelength of 575.92593n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#BDDE1E is #CCFF33.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#BDDE1E is #BD2. The Closest Color to #BDDE1E is #ADFF2F. Official Name of #BDDE1E Hex Code is Fuego.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#BDDE1E is 15 Cyan 0 Magenta 86 Yellow 13 Black and #BDDE1E CMY is 15, 0, 86.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#BDDE1E is hsl(70,76,49,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(70, 86, 87).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#BDDE1E is 47.34, 63.16, 10.92.
Hex8 Value of #BDDE1E is #BDDE1EFF. Decimal Value of #BDDE1E is 12443166 and Octal Value of #BDDE1E is 57357036. Binary Value of #BDDE1E is 10111101, 11011110, 11110 and Android of #BDDE1E is 4290633246 / 0xffbdde1e.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#BDDE1E is 0.39, 0.52, 0.52 and YIQ Color Space of #BDDE1E is 190.245, 42.0249, -66.7299.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#BDDE1E is 60.05, 73.97, 11.74.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#BDDE1E is 83.53, -32.65, 78.68.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#BDDE1E is 83.53, -14.71, 92.16.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#BDDE1E is 83.53, 85.19, 112.54. Hunter Lab variable of #BDDE1E is 79.47, -32.75, 47.48.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#BDDE1E

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
